π° Classic Cheesecake Recipe
π Prep Time: 20 mins
π Bake Time: 1 hour
βοΈ Chill Time: 4+ hours (best overnight)
π½ Serves: 12
β Ingredients:
Crust:
-
1 Β½ cups graham cracker crumbs (about 10 full crackers)
-
ΒΌ cup granulated sugar
-
Β½ c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, melted
Filling:
-
4 (8 oz) packages cream cheese, softened (32 oz total)
-
1 cup granulated sugar
-
1 tsp vanilla extract
-
4 large eggs
-
β cup sour cream
-
β cup heavy cream
π§βπ³ Instructions:
1. Prepare the crust:
-
Preheat oven to 325Β°F (160Β°C).
-
Mix graham cracker crumbs, sugar, and melted butter in a bowl.
-
Press the mixture into the bottom of a 9-inch springform pan.
-
Bake for 10 minutes. Remove and let cool.
2. Make the filling:
-
Beat cream cheese with a mixer until smooth.
-
Add sugar and vanilla; mix well.
-
Add eggs one at a time, beating slowly and scraping the bowl after each.
-
Mix in sour cream and heavy cream until smooth.
3. Bake:
-
Pour filling into the crust.
-
Tap the pan to remove air bubbles.
-
Place the pan in a water bath (wrap pan in foil to prevent leaks).
-
Bake for 50β60 minutes until the center is almost set (slightly jiggly in the middle).
4. Cool:
-
Turn off the oven and crack the door open.
-
Let the cheesecake cool in the oven for 1 hour.
-
Remove and cool to room temperature.
-
Chill in the refrigerator at least 4 hours or overnight.
π Optional Toppings:
-
Fresh berries or berry sauce
-
Caramel or chocolate drizzle
-
Whipped cream
-
Crushed nuts
